Kamal Cement & Infrastructure Ltd has proposed setting up a 2Mt (in two phases of 1Mt each) cement plant in the Satna district with an investment of Rs 1,000 crore.  
 
The company will join hands with the Rashtriya group to set up the unit. The project will be executed on a turnkey basis and will undertake mining, limestone, storage, clinkerisation, cement grinding and packing. The company has also proposed to set up two captive power plants of 30 Mw each at the site. 
 
 "They are setting up the plant in Satna since Satna has wide deposits of limestone. The site will also have a geographical advantage to cater for markets of Uttar Pradesh, Bihar, Delhi, Haryana and other northern states; the apex empowerment committee on investment will consider their demands and we will respond accordingly," said a senior official in the department of industries.
